disease > psychopathology > delusion > Capgras syndrome

Preferred term

Capgras syndrome  

Definition(s)

  • Capgras delusion is a psychiatric disorder in which a person holds a delusion that a friend, spouse, parent, or other close family member (or pet) has been replaced by an identical impostor. It is named after Joseph Capgras (1873–1950), a French psychiatrist. (Wikipedia)
